Mixed butene streams containing butene-1 and isobutylene and optionally butene-2 are hydroformylated under conditions that hydroformylates all the monomers to yield a mixture of valeraldehydes. Higher temperatures and/or longer residence times and/or higher partial pressure of carbon monoxide than in conventional processes are used to ensure hydroformylation of all the monomers.

(EN) A process in which an alpha-olefin containing n carbon atoms is reacted with hydrogen and carbon monoxide in the presence of a complex rhodium-containing catalyst and a base to form aldehydes containing 2n+2 carbon atoms, wherein the reaction is conducted at a temperature and pressure sufficient to remove at least part of the product from the reaction mixture by vaporization or stripping. A process is also disclosed in which an alpha-olefin containing n carbon atoms is reacted with hydrogen and carbon monoxide in the presence of a complex rhodium-containing catalyst not containing halogen, free ligand and Lewis base to form aldehyde containing n+1 carbon atoms, wherein the reaction is conducted at a temperature and pressure sufficient to remove at least part of the product from the reaction mixture by vaporization.
